区块链运用侧链 区块链侧链是什么

发布时间:2025-12-20 12:44:02 浏览:3 分类:比特币资讯
大小:509.7 MB 版本:v6.141.0
欧易官网正版APP,返佣推荐码:61662149

随着区块链技术的快速发展,扩容问题逐渐成为制约其大规模应用的核心瓶颈。侧链技术作为解决这一问题的关键方案,通过将部分交易转移到附属链上处理,在保障安全性的同时大幅提升系统性能。本文将深入探讨侧链的技术原理、典型实现模式及行业应用,并分析其面临的挑战与发展前景。

1.侧链技术的基本原理与架构设计

侧链本质上是一条与主链并行运行但具备独立功能的区块链,通过双向锚定机制实现资产在主链与侧链间的安全转移。其核心技术架构包含三个关键组件:

双向锚定机制:采用对称式和非对称式两种实现方式。对称式锚定要求主链与侧链使用相同的共识算法,通过简单支付验证实现跨链通信;非对称式则允许不同共识机制的链间交互,例如PoW主链与PoS侧链的资产转移。该机制确保资产在转移过程中始终保持总量恒定,避免通货膨胀风险。

区块链中继系统:作为连接主链与侧链的"桥梁"轻量级客户端验证区块头信息,实现跨链状态同步。具体实现时,中继系统需要持续监控主链的特定输出,一旦检测到资产锁定交易,便在侧链生成对应数量的凭证资产。这种设计使得侧链能够读取主链数据而无需信任第三方,保持了去中心化特性。

共识机制适配层:为解决主链与侧链可能存在的共识差异,侧链协议需包含专门的适配模块。例如,比特币主链采用PoW共识,而侧链可根据需求选择PoS、DPoS等高效共识算法,显著提升交易处理速度。该层还负责处理链间消息传递的安全验证,防止恶意节点伪造跨链交易。

2.侧链的核心技术实现方案

目前主流的侧链实现方案主要包括以下三种模式:

实现方案 技术特点 代表项目 适用场景
联合锚定方案 由多方签名控制资产锁定与释放 LiquidNetwork 高频交易、交易所清算
SPV证明方案 通过Merkle树路径验证交易状态 RSK 智能合约、DeFi应用
驱动链方案 矿工直接参与侧链验证 比特币主网扩容

在具体实施过程中,SPV证明方案因其去中心化程度最高而受到广泛关注。该方案的工作原理是:当用户需要将资产从主链转移至侧链时,首先在主链创建特殊输出;侧链节点通过扫描主链区块头,生成包含工作量证明的SPV验证;通过验证后,侧链即释放等额资产。整个过程无需信任第三方,仅依靠密码学保证安全性。

驱动链方案则创新性地将矿工纳入侧链生态系统。矿工除了负责主链区块打包外,还承担对侧链状态变化的投票权。当侧链需要将资产返回主链时,由矿工集体签名决定是否解锁主链资产。这种设计既利用了现有矿工网络的安全性,又避免了创建新的信任体系。

3.侧链技术的实际应用场景

金融领域:侧链在跨境支付中展现出显著优势。通过建立专门处理国际汇款的侧链,交易确认时间可从小时级缩短至秒级,手续费降低超80%。例如,LiquidNetwork通过联合锚定实现比特币在交易所间的快速转移,显著提升资金利用效率。

供应链管理:在商品溯源场景中,主链记录关键节点信息保证数据不可篡改,侧链则处理商品流动中的高频数据更新。这种架构既保证了核心数据的绝对安全,又通过侧链的高吞吐量满足实际业务需求。家电行业已有企业采用该方案,实现从生产到销售的全程可追溯。

数字身份认证:将敏感身份信息存储于侧链,通过零知识证明实现主链验证而不暴露具体数据。这种设计特别适用于需要保护用户隐私的政务系统和医疗数据管理场景。

游戏与NFT领域:侧链为区块链游戏提供高频率交互支持。游戏内普通道具交易在侧链完成,仅将稀有装备变更记录同步至主链。这种方案有效解决了游戏场景中高并发交易与区块链低吞吐量之间的矛盾,为玩家提供近乎实时的交互体验。

4.侧链技术面临的挑战与局限性

尽管侧链技术展现出巨大潜力,但其在标准化、安全性、用户体验等方面仍存在明显短板:

安全性与去中心化的平衡:联合锚定方案虽然效率较高,但依赖多重签名委员会又在一定程度上回归了中心化模式。如何在不牺牲安全性的前提下提高性能,仍是技术优化的重点方向。

跨链通信标准化缺失:不同侧链项目采用各异的通信协议,导致互操作性不足。这显著增加了开发者的适配成本,也限制了侧链生态的协同发展。业界亟需建立统一的跨链通信标准,如同互联网时代的TCP/IP协议。

共识机制冲突风险:当主链与侧链采用不同共识算法时,可能存在潜在的攻击向量。例如,PoS侧链的无效块可能通过特定方式影响PoW主链的稳定性,这类新型攻击手段尚需深入研究。

5.侧链技术的未来发展趋势

随着区块链技术的持续演进,侧链将在以下方向实现突破:

模块化侧链架构:未来侧链将向可插拔的模块化方向发展,开发者可根据具体需求灵活选择共识、存储、通信等组件。这种架构既降低了开发门槛,又能满足多样化业务场景的需求。

与Layer2技术的深度融合:状态通道、Rollups等Layer2方案将与侧链形成互补关系。状态通道适用于高频双边交易,而侧链更适合复杂多方交互场景,二者结合可构建多层次的扩容解决方案。

行业特定侧链的兴起:为满足不同行业的特殊需求,专门针对金融、医疗、政务等领域的垂直侧链将不断涌现。这些侧链将在合规性、性能指标、功能特性等方面进行专业化定制,推动区块链技术的产业化应用。

关于"区块链运用侧链"常见问题

1.侧链与主链的本质区别是什么?

侧链是具有独立功能的区块链,可根据业务需求定制共识机制和区块参数,而主链通常保持最大的安全性和去中心化程度。

2.资产在侧链间转移是否存在风险?

通过密码学保证的双向锚定机制,资产转移过程具有原子性,即要么全部成功要么全部失败,不存在中间状态风险。

3.侧链是否会影响主链的安全性?

设计良好的侧链协议会将安全问题限制在侧链内部,即便侧链被攻击也不会危及主链安全。

4.目前哪些公链已支持侧链开发?

比特币通过Liquid、RSK实现侧链功能,以太坊则可通过POANetwork等方案构建侧链生态系统。

5.企业如何选择适合的侧链方案?

需综合考量交易频率、安全性要求、开发成本等因素。低频高安全场景适合SPV方案,高频交易则可选择联合锚定。

6.侧链技术的性能提升具体表现在哪些方面?

通过优化共识机制和区块参数,侧链的TPS可达主链的10-100倍,确认时间可从分钟级缩短至秒级。

7.侧链与跨链协议有何本质区别?

侧链是主链的功能扩展,资产所有权仍由主链控制;跨链则是不同主权链间的价值交换。

8.侧链开发需要哪些核心技术能力?

需要掌握密码学应用、共识算法设计、P2P网络通信等关键技术,同时需深入理解主链的核心协议。